A decrease court might not rule against a binding precedent, even when it feels that it is unjust; it might only express the hope that a higher court or maybe the legislature will reform the rule in question. If your court believes that developments or trends in legal reasoning render the precedent unhelpful, and wishes to evade it and help the regulation evolve, it may both hold that the precedent is inconsistent with subsequent authority, or that it should be distinguished by some material difference between the facts of your cases; some jurisdictions allow for any judge to recommend that an appeal be performed.

The Supreme Court's explanation from Fida Muhammad v. Government of Khyber Pakhtunkhwa and others (2021 SCMR 1895), Obviously distinguished between up-gradation and promotion. Promotion includes a shift to the higher position with increased responsibilities and rank. Upgradation, within the other hand, presents financial relief by placing an employee inside of a higher fork out scale, without switching their career duties or position. It's a mechanism designed to address the stagnation of employees who have remained within the same fork out scale for a lengthy time, particularly when they lack chances for promotion.
